International Tribunal and Financial Resources for Reconstruction
The push for an international tribunal to address war crimes represents a significant evolution in international law, serving as a potential deterrent against future violations. Furthermore, integrating frozen Russian assets for Ukraine’s reconstruction presents a strategic innovation in war reparations, heralding new financial mechanisms in post-conflict recovery. The EU’s Unified Stand: Imperative on the World Stage
With the EU represented by diverse political parties at forums addressing Ukraine’s support, the message was unanimous: no diplomatic negotiations should transpire without Ukraine’s inclusion. This alignment not only consolidates EU’s foreign policy but also reassures affected nations of a united front. This cohesive stance potentially shifts power dynamics, affecting global alliances, particularly with the United States.
Facilitating Refugee Integration: A Pathway to Citizenship
Considering the influx of Ukrainian refugees, tangible support mechanisms like recognizing foreign qualifications and easing job market entry are vital. These strategies could revolutionize refugee integration, providing a blueprint for future humanitarian crises.
